What is a Temporary Ags Health Medical Coding?

A Temporary Ags Health Medical Coding job involves working for Ags Health, a healthcare services company, on a short-term basis to assign standardized codes to medical diagnoses and procedures. Medical coders at Ags Health review patient records and translate clinical information into codes used for billing, insurance claims, and data analysis. Temporary positions may help cover staff shortages, special projects, or seasonal increases in workload. Candidates typically need knowledge of coding systems like ICD-10, CPT, and HCPCS, as well as attention to detail and familiarity with healthcare documentation.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Temporary Ags Health Medical Coder?

To thrive as a Temporary Ags Health Medical Coder, you need a detailed understanding of medical terminology, ICD-10/CPT/HCPCS coding systems, and typically a relevant certification such as CPC or CCS. Familiarity with medical coding software, electronic health records (EHR) systems, and healthcare compliance tools is essential. Strong att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ication are valuable soft skills for accuracy and collaboration. These skills are crucial for ensuring precise medical documentation, regulatory compliance, and efficient reimbursement processes.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als in Temporary Ags Health Medical Coding positions, and how can they be managed?

Temporary Ags Health Medical Coders often encounter the challenge of quickly adapting to different healthcare systems and coding software, as each assignment may vary. They must also stay updated on frequent changes to coding standards and regulations. Effective time management and strong attention to detail are crucial, especially when working independently or with limited supervision. Building good communication with permanent staff and proactively seeking clarification on unfamiliar processes can help ensure accuracy and productivity in a temporary role.

About The Position

  • Assign the principal and secondary diagnoses and procedures by thoroughly reviewing all documentation in the medical record utilizing knowledge of anatomy, physiology, medical terminology, and pathology.
  • Review the discharge summary, history and physical, physician progress notes, consultation reports, radiology, laboratory, pathology, operative records, emergency room record to accurately assign diagnosis and / or procedure. Determine diagnoses that were treated, monitored, and evaluated and procedures done during the episode of care and assign appropriate codes.
  • Assigns and ensures correct code selection following Official Coding Guidelines and compliance with federal and insurance regulations.
  • Ensure the diagnoses and procedures are sequenced in order of their clinical significance to accurately assign the appropriate DRG, APC or payment tier under the Prospective Payment system to guarantee accurate reimbursement.
  • Review coding for accuracy and completeness prior to submission to billing.
  • Abstract required medical and demographic information from the medical record and enter the data into the system to ensure accuracy of the database. Responsible for correcting any data found to be in error after reviewing the medical record and comparing with system entries.
  • Ensures all required component parts of the medical record that pertain to coding are present, accurate and comply with CMS, JCAHO, and client requirements. Identify incomplete or conflicting documentation in the medical record and formulate a physician query to obtain missing documentation and/ or clarification to accurately complete the coding process. Utilize computer applications and resources essential to completing the coding process efficiently.
  • Meets coding quality and quantity expectations
